Urpautils

Latest version: v0.10.1

Safety actively analyzes 724087 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 2 of 3

0.6.0

Added
- [15](https://github.com/ultimaterpa/urpautils/pull/15) : decorator `repeat` for repeating an action on element
- [17](https://github.com/ultimaterpa/urpautils/pull/17) : function `check_elements_reversed` which raises error if an element is found

0.5.0

Added
- [13](https://github.com/ultimaterpa/urpautils/issues/13) : function `justify_ico`

0.4.3

Fixed
- [12](https://github.com/ultimaterpa/urpautils/pull/12) : Fixed sending attachments with `send_email_notification()`

0.4.2

Changed
- Option to set debug level for `send_email_notification()` function

0.4.1

Changed
- `Csv_dict_writer` now requires `field_names` for initialization

0.4.0

- Added function `read_json()`
- [7](https://github.com/ultimaterpa/urpautils/issues/7) : Added option to read csv file as dictionary to function `csv_read_rows()` via `as_dict` arg
- [7](https://github.com/ultimaterpa/urpautils/issues/7) : Added class `Csv_dict_writer` for writing dictionary to csv
- Added optional arg `sep` to `csv_create_file()`. If provided it writes "sep=<separator>" to first line of the file so it opens correctly in Excel

Page 2 of 3

© 2025 Safety CLI Cybersecurity Inc. All Rights Reserved.